The Labour Party have “high hopes for the by-election” in May.
That’s according to Junior Minister Ann Phelan who says she has every intention of joining her party’s candidate, Carlow Councillor Willie Quinn, on the campaign trail in the coming weeks.
With just over 9 weeks to go, Fianna Fáil candidate Bobby Aylward yesterday announced that party leader Mícheál Martin would be visiting the constituency at least once a week.
Speaking to KCLR Minister Phelan says we can expect a number of senior Labour members to also make an appearance.
